“Cape Cod is the bared and bended arm of Massachusetts. . .” – from “Cape Cod: The Shipwreck” (1865) by Henry David Thoreau.
“Bared & Bended” is a series of abstract landscaped chronicling artist Frank Yamrus' first winter in Provincetown, Massachusetts. While Yamrus has frequented Cape Cod for over two decades, it was not until 2003 that he experienced the region’s harsher months. Seeking space from a spiraling personal relationship and solitude for artistic inspiration, Yamrus headed to Provincetown, the place he considers his true home. As part of his daily routine, Yamrus wandered through the frozen landscapes of the Cape. During these walks, he found his psychological space mirrored in the snow, fog, mist, and rain, and with these elements he created the images included in this body of work.
Frank Yamrus has been exhibiting his work internationally for over twenty years, with his photographs represented in numerous public collections, including the Museum of Fine Arts, Houston; the Victoria and Albert Museum, London; the Los Angeles County Museum of Art; the Worcester Art Museum, Massachusetts; and the Denver Art Museum; among others.
